A Journey Under the Sea

The SEA Aquarium Singapore is home to more than 100,000 marine animals from over 1,000 species, spread across 49 different habitats. The aquarium’s layout takes visitors through various aquatic environments, each meticulously designed to replicate the natural habitats of its inhabitants. From the majestic open ocean to the mysterious deep sea, the SEA Aquarium offers a glimpse into the fascinating world beneath the waves.


The Open Ocean Habitat

One of the main highlights of the SEA Aquarium is the Open Ocean Habitat, featuring a massive viewing panel that measures 36 meters wide and 8.3 meters tall. This vast tank is home to a diverse array of marine life, including manta rays, groupers, and leopard sharks. The panoramic view allows visitors to feel as though they are walking on the ocean floor, surrounded by schools of fish and other sea creatures.


Unique Marine Species

The SEA Aquarium is not just about size; it’s also about diversity. Visitors can marvel at rare and exotic marine species, such as the endangered scalloped hammerhead shark, the majestic Indo-Pacific bottlenose dolphin, and the fascinating giant moray eel. Each exhibit is designed to educate visitors about the unique characteristics and conservation status of these incredible creatures.


Interactive and Educational Experiences

Beyond the awe-inspiring exhibits, the SEA Aquarium offers a range of interactive and educational experiences. The touch pool allows visitors, especially children, to get up close and personal with starfish, sea cucumbers, and other gentle marine animals. Additionally, the aquarium hosts daily feeding sessions and educational talks, providing insights into the behaviors and diets of various species.


Conservation and Sustainability

The SEA Aquarium is dedicated to marine conservation and sustainability. It actively participates in research and breeding programs for endangered species and works to raise public awareness about the importance of protecting marine ecosystems. Through its various initiatives, the aquarium aims to inspire visitors to take action in preserving our oceans for future generations.
